“Single Feed Options” allows Disabling or Enabling Single Feed Support.
If “Disable Single Feed Support” is selected, when the P330i Card Printer runs out of
cards in the feeder, the LCD display will read OUT OF CARDS. To continue, press
the panel button.
If “Enable Single Feed Support” is selected, when the P330i Card Printer runs out of
cards in the feeder it will wait until a card is inserted in the single-card slot or cards
are loaded in the feeder, and then will automatically continue.
Printing a Sample Card
Sample card designs are installed with the printer driver. Sample cards require Microsoft Word
or Microsoft Paint application software. The cards are accessed via the Start menu. Select
Start, select Programs, select Zebra Card Printers, and select a sample card, or follow the
directions below to design a card.
Follow these steps to design and print your first card:
1. Launch Microsoft Word Software. Depending on your computer configuration this may be
done by double-clicking an icon on your desktop, or by clicking the Windows Start icon,
selecting Programs, and navigating to Microsoft Word
2. Go to the File menu and choose Page Setup.
3. Select the Paper Size tab, choose Card. Under orientation, select Landscape.
4. Select the Margins tab, and set the Top, Bottom, Left, and Right margins to 0 (zero).
5. Click OK to close the Page Setup window.
6. The card appears on the screen.
7. Design a card with both black and colored text and with colored pictures (see example
below).

Note • For cards thinner than 20 mils (0.51 mm) or thicker than 40 mils (1.02 mm), the card
design must be limited to (1) no more than two 30 mm x 30 mm areas of full color, (2) black
information (text and barcode, for example) must cover no more than 50% of the card area,
and (3) there must be at least a 5mm unprinted border along all edges.
For cards with thickness between 20 mils (0.51 mm) and 40 mils (1.02 mm), these
restrictions do not apply; full color printing is permitted edge to edge in both directions.
